Way Oils

The Lube Rite line of way oil is specially designed to provide the optimum balance between stick and slip offering the smoothest, most accurate operation of ways and machine tools. Each fluid is formulated with high performance technology to ensure your operation is free from corrosion and staining, provides maximum wear protection, and offers excellent oxidation and thermal stability.

Features Benefits
Excellent stick-slip properties Smooth operation allows for a flawless finish, reducing scrap and increasing output
Excellent wear protection, thermal and oxidations stability, and rust and staining protection Providing a longer, more reliable fluid life; extending drain intervals and lowering overall fluid costs
Good filterability and demulsibility Will not mix and interfere with machining properties of the metalworking fluid in-use

Performance Specifications

• Cincinnati Machine Tool P-47 (ISO 68)
• Cincinnati Machine Tool P-50 (ISO 220)
 

Typical Properties

LubeRite Way Oil 68 220
ISO Grade 68 220
Viscosity, cSt at 40 °C 68 220
Viscosity, cSt at 100 °C 6.70 8.50
Specific Gravity at 15.6 °C 0.8778 0.8908
Viscosity Index 100 98
Flash Point, °F 434 478
Pour Point, °C -18 -10
Stick-slip, ASTM D2877 0.75 0.73
Copper Corrosion, ASTM D130 Pass Pass
 
 

Directions for Use and Fluid Selection

Lube Rite Way Oils are received ready for use.

 
 

Hydraulic Fluids

The Lube Rite line of hydraulic fluids is specially designed to provide the optimum performance requirements to ensure that your hydraulic application is running as effectively and efficiently as possible. Each fluid is formulated with high performance technology to ensure your operation is free from corrosion and staining, provides maximum wear protection, and offers excellent oxidation and thermal stability.

 
Features Benefits
Excellent wear protection, thermal and oxidations stability, and rust and staining protection Providing a longer, more reliable fluid life; extending drain intervals and lowering overall fluid costs
Anti-foaming Ensures fluid operation is smooth and efficient
Filterability and demulsibility Water will impact the viscosity of the fluid and solids can cause excess wear and tear on the pump. Both contaminants will decrease fluid pressure making each pump work hard to transfer the same amount of energy. Removing these will ensure efficient operation.
 

Performance Specifications

• Cincinnati Machine Tool P68 (ISO 32), P-70 (ISO 46), and P-69 (ISO 68)
• US Steel 127, 136
• DIN 51524 Part II
• Denison HF-0, HF-2
• Eaton/Vickers I-286S
• Eaton/Vickers M-2950-S
 

Typical Properties

LubeRite Hydraulic 32 46 68
ISO Grade 32 46 68
Viscosity, cSt at 40 °C 32 46 68
Viscosity, cSt at 100 °C 5.72 7.29 9.35
Specific Gravity at 15.6 °C .0.875 0.879 0.886
Viscosity Index 120 120 113
Flash Point, °F 420 440 460
Pour Point, °C -30 -28 -20
Rust Test D665 A and B Pass Pass Pass
Copper Corrosion, ASTM D130 1A 1A 1A
Oxidation Stability D943, Hrs 6,000+ 5,500+ 4,500+
 

Directions for Use and Fluid Selection

Lube Rite Hydraulic fluids are received ready for use. There are three major pump designs and each type must be treated on a case-by-case basis. Devising a step by step check to determine optimum viscosity range will ensure you are running efficiently and effectively. Be sure to consult with pump manufacturer to collect design limitations and optimum operating characteristics, including optimum viscosity range. Measuring actual operating temperatures is also important. Diligently evaluating your operation and environment will ensure you are choosing the best fluid for your application.

 
 

Industrial Gear Oils

Lube Rite industrial gear oils are designed for heavy duty enclosed gear drives and reducers operating under heavy or shock loads. They are formulated with the highest quality base stocks and state of the art additive technology. Lube Rite Industrial Gear oils offer outstanding extreme pressure performance, resistance to oxidation, high thermal stability, and will enhance lubrication under the most severe conditions.

 
Features Benefits
Excellent wear protection, thermal and oxidations stability, and rust and staining protection Providing a longer, more reliable fluid life; extending drain intervals and lowering overall fluid costs.
Anti-foaming with advanced water separation Ensures fluid operation is smooth and efficient, protecting gears from damaging entrapped air or water and increasing the useful life of the fluid as well as gears.
 

Performance Specifications

• AGMA 9005
• US Steel 224
• DIN 51517 Part 1, 2, and 3
• Cincinnati Milacron
• Enclosed gears
• Plain and antifriction bearings
• Gear reducers
• Equipment operating under heavy loads
 

Typical Properties

LubeRite Industrial Gear 68 150 220
ISO Grade 68 150 220
Viscosity, cSt at 40 °C 68 150 220
Viscosity, cSt at 100 °C 8.65 14.6 18.9
Specific Gravity at 15.6 °C .0.8660 0.8920 0.8920
Flash Point, °F 410 430 445
FZG, Suffing Load Capacity, Fail Stage ASTM D5182 12 12 12
Timken OK Load, lbs 60 65 65
Foaming Tendency 60 65 65
Copper Corrosion, ASTM D130 1A 1A 1A
Steel Corrosion, ASTM 665B Pass Pass Pass
 

Directions for Use and Fluid Selection

Lube Rite Industrial Gear oils are received ready for use. When choosing an industrial gear, keep in mind the viscosity grade that is specified by the original equipment manufacturer which is typically found in the equipment maintenance manual. If that is not available, use the AGMA 9005 standard. This standard considers the different gear geometries, operating temperatures, and viscosity index of the fluid, as well as other properties, to help make the most appropriate choice for each individual operation.
